NetBackup™ for Oracle 管理指南
- 简介
- 安装 NetBackup for Oracle
- 为 Oracle 管理员配置 RBAC
- 管理 Oracle 发现和数据库
- 管理 Oracle 凭据
- 配置 Oracle 策略
- 执行 Oracle 的备份和还原
- Oracle 克隆
- NetBackup Copilot for Oracle
- 使用通用共享配置 OIP (Oracle Copilot)
- 具有即时访问的 Oracle Copilot
- 带有 Snapshot Client 的 NetBackup for Oracle
- 适用于 Oracle 的 NetBackup 直接重复数据删除
- 故障排除
- 排除 RMAN 备份或还原错误
- 附录 A. 重复数据删除最佳做法
- 附录 B. Snapshot Client 对 SFRAC 的支持
- 附录 C. UNIX 和 Linux 系统上基于脚本的块级增量式 (BLI) 备份(不带 RMAN)
- 附录 D. XML 存档程序
- 附录 E. 注册授权位置
检查日志以确定错误源
本主题介绍了如何检查日志以确定错误源。
检查日志
- 检查 bporaexp 或 bporaimp 日志。
如果在 bporaexp 或 bporaimp 命令的 parfile 中指定了 LOG 参数,则此命令会将日志写入作为 LOG 参数的变量指定的文件。如果尚未指定 LOG,则命令会将日志信息显示在屏幕上。
例如,安装或配置不正确会导致以下常见问题:
未设置 ORACLE_HOME 环境变量。
bporaexp 或 bporaimp 程序不能连接到目标数据库。
在使用 bporaexp 和 bporaimp,以及向操作系统目录写入备份映像时,这些日志是错误日志记录和跟踪的唯一来源。
- 检查 NetBackup 日志。
在 Windows 上,要检查的第一个 NetBackup 日志是 install_path\NetBackup\logs\bporaexp\log.mmddyy 或 install_path\NetBackup\logs\bporaimp\log.mmddyy。
在 UNIX 上,要检查的第一个 NetBackup 日志是 /usr/openv/netbackup/logs/bporaexp/log.mmddyy 或 /usr/openv/netbackup/logs/bporaimp/log.mmddyy。
检查这些日志,从中查找说明如何确定错误来源的任何消息。
NetBackup 客户端写入这些日志,并且它们包含以下内容:
来自 bporaexp 和 bporaimp 的请求
bporaexp 和 bporaimp 与 NetBackup 进程之间的活动。
如果日志不含任何消息,则可能存在以下情况:
bporaexp 或 bporaimp 在从 NetBackup 请求服务之前已终止。
bphdb(如果已由调度程序或图形用户界面启动)未成功启动 Shell 脚本。在 bphdb 日志中查找 stderr 和 stdout 文件。
尝试通过命令行运行 XML 导出或 XML 导入脚本文件以确定问题。
在 UNIX 上,该错误通常是由 bphdb 本身或导出/导入脚本文件的文件权限问题造成的。
确保在 Oracle 策略配置的“备份选择”列表中正确输入了完整的 XML 导出或导入脚本文件名。此外,还要验证此脚本名称是否正确。
有关调试日志和报告的更多信息,请参考 NetBackup 管理指南,第 I 卷。